在当今数字化时代,互联网服务提供商(ISP)和数据中心运营商(DCO)面临着如何高效、安全地管理大量数据传输的需求,本文将深入探讨如何在IDC服务器上成功上传文件,并提供一系列优化策略以提升效率。
准备工作
-
选择合适的文件类型:确定要上传的文件格式,例如图片、视频、文档等,以便于后续处理和分析。
-
检查网络连接质量:确保稳定的互联网接入,避免因断网导致的上传中断或速度减慢。
-
备份重要数据:在进行任何操作之前,务必先对关键数据进行完整备份,以防万一发生意外情况时能够迅速恢复。
图片来源于网络,如有侵权联系删除
-
了解目标服务器环境:熟悉目标服务器的操作系统、软件配置以及存储空间限制等信息,这有助于更好地规划上传方案。
-
使用压缩工具减小文件体积:对于大型文件,可以使用WinRAR、7-Zip等压缩工具将其打包成ZIP包,从而节省带宽和时间成本。
-
准备必要的登录凭证:包括账号密码、密钥或其他身份验证信息,以便顺利访问远程服务器并进行相关操作。
-
考虑安全性因素:如果涉及敏感信息,应采取加密措施保护数据的机密性和完整性;同时注意遵守相关法律法规和政策规定。
-
测试本地网络性能:通过下载大容量文件来评估当前网络的实际传输速率,这将帮助预估整个过程的时长。
-
制定应急预案:设想可能出现的问题及其解决方案,比如网络波动、服务器故障等,提前做好应对准备。
-
记录操作日志:每次上传结束后都要及时记录下详细的步骤和相关参数,便于日后查阅和维护。
上传过程详解
-
建立SSH连接:
- 打开终端窗口或使用Putty等其他客户端程序;
- 输入IP地址和端口号;
- 输入用户名和密码进行身份认证。
-
切换至目标目录:
- 使用
cd
命令导航到存放待上传文件的本地文件夹所在位置。
- 使用
-
创建远程目录:
- 在远程服务器上创建一个新的空目录用于接收即将上传的数据;
mkdir /path/to/destination/directory
-
执行文件传输:
- 采用SCP协议直接从本地复制文件到远程服务器指定路径;
- 示例命令为:
scp filename.txt username@server_ip:/path/to/remote_directory/
-
监控进度条:
观察屏幕上的进度指示器,确认文件是否正在按预期进行传输。
-
完成后的验证工作:
图片来源于网络,如有侵权联系删除
- 检查远程服务器上的新目录中是否有预期的文件存在;
- 可以通过
ls
命令列出该目录下的所有文件进行检查。
-
清理现场:
确认任务完成后删除本地的临时文件及生成的日志记录。
-
关闭SSH会话:
- 使用
exit
或logout
退出当前的SSH会话以确保安全。
- 使用
常见问题分析与解决方法
-
网络不稳定导致的中断:定期重启路由器和调制解调器,尝试更换不同的线路或者联系ISP寻求技术支持。
-
权限不足无法写入磁盘:检查账户权限设置,必要时提升权限级别或者咨询系统管理员获取更多权限。
-
超时错误提示:可能是由于距离过远导致的延迟较高所致,可以考虑缩短传输距离或在高峰时段避开拥堵时段再行上传。
-
文件损坏无法读取:重新下载一次原始文件进行比较对比,若仍存在问题则需联系供应商获取正版授权或许可证。
持续优化建议
-
定期更新设备和软件版本,以获得更好的性能和安全保障。
-
利用云存储服务如AWS S3、Azure Blob Storage等进行离线批量上传和处理。
-
对于频繁需要更新的内容,可以采用增量备份的方式只同步修改过的部分,而不是全部重传。
-
考虑采用更高效的编码方式压缩数据后再上传,但要注意不要过度压缩以至于影响画质或清晰度。
-
如果条件允许的话,还可以探索利用区块链技术来实现去中心化的数据共享和管理模式。
要想在IDC服务器上高效地上传文件并保持良好的用户体验,我们需要综合考虑各种因素并结合实际情况做出合理的选择和调整,只有这样才能够真正发挥出IDC服务的最大价值并为用户提供更加优质的服务体验。
标签: #IDC服务器上传文件
评论列表